Q: Does replacing the 3HAC044361-001 harness require axis re-teaching?
In the majority of standard IRB 4600 configurations, no axis re-teaching is required after a direct harness swap, provided the robot base frame and tool center point (TCP) calibration data remain intact in the IRC5 controller. If the robot base was disturbed during the service procedure, a base frame calibration check is recommended before resuming production.
Q: Is the 3HAC044361-001 compatible with both IRC5 standard and IRC5 compact cabinets?
Yes. The harness is compatible with both IRC5 standard and IRC5 compact cabinet variants. The connector interface at the cabinet entry point is identical across both configurations for the IRB 4600 series, requiring no adapter or modification.
Q: Will the harness replacement affect my fieldbus communication configuration?
No. The 3HAC044361-001 carries resolver/encoder feedback signals and motor power conductors only. It does not affect the fieldbus communication layer — DeviceNet, PROFIBUS, EtherNet/IP, or PROFINET configurations in the IRC5 DSQC modules remain fully intact after harness replacement.

Q: What is the recommended spare inventory strategy for this part?
For facilities operating three or more IRB 4600 units, maintaining one 3HAC044361-001 harness as a critical spare is a standard recommendation. The typical mean time between harness replacements in high-cycle automotive and general assembly applications is 18,000–25,000 operating hours, depending on motion profile and environmental conditions.
